Drones target Moscow and Leningrad Oblast, flights disrupted at major airports

Moscow and Leningrad Oblast came under drone attacks on the night of 2-3 April. Local authorities have reported that some of the drones were downed.
Source: Moscow Mayor Sergei Sobyanin; Leningrad Oblast Governor Aleksandr Drozdenko; Astra Telegram channel
Quote from Sobyanin: "Air defence systems downed a drone heading towards Moscow. Emergency services are working at the scene where debris fell."
Details: Sobyanin later reported that another drone had been destroyed. Temporary restrictions on arrivals and departures were introduced at several Russian airports due to the drone threat. These included Vnukovo, Pulkovo and Tunoshna airports.
Leningrad Oblast was also targeted in the drone attack. Drozdenko claimed that seven drones had been downed there and added that two people had been injured.
